#include <string.h>
#include <sys/types.h>
#include <unistd.h>

#include <string>

#include <android-base/file.h>
#include <android/log.h>
#include <gtest/gtest.h>
#include <private/android_logger.h>

static const std::string myFilename = "/data/misc/recovery/inject.txt";
static const std::string myContent = "Hello World\nWelcome to my recovery\n";

// Failure is expected on systems that do not deliver either the
// recovery-persist or recovery-refresh executables. Tests also require
// a reboot sequence of test to truly verify.

static ssize_t __pmsg_fn(log_id_t logId, char prio, const char *filename,
                         const char *buf, size_t len, void *arg) {
  EXPECT_EQ(LOG_ID_SYSTEM, logId);
  EXPECT_EQ(ANDROID_LOG_INFO, prio);
  EXPECT_NE(std::string::npos, myFilename.find(filename));
  EXPECT_EQ(myContent, buf);
  EXPECT_EQ(myContent.size(), len);
  EXPECT_EQ(nullptr, arg);
  return len;
}

// recovery.refresh - May fail. Requires recovery.inject, two reboots,
//                    then expect success after second reboot.
TEST(recovery, refresh) {
  EXPECT_EQ(0, access("/system/bin/recovery-refresh", F_OK));

  ssize_t ret = __android_log_pmsg_file_read(
      LOG_ID_SYSTEM, ANDROID_LOG_INFO, "recovery/", __pmsg_fn, nullptr);
  if (ret == -ENOENT) {
    EXPECT_LT(0, __android_log_pmsg_file_write(LOG_ID_SYSTEM, ANDROID_LOG_INFO,
        myFilename.c_str(), myContent.c_str(), myContent.size()));

    fprintf(stderr, "injected test data, requires two intervening reboots "
        "to check for replication\n");
  }
  EXPECT_EQ(static_cast<ssize_t>(myContent.size()), ret);
}

// recovery.persist - Requires recovery.inject, then a reboot, then
//                    expect success after for this test on that boot.
TEST(recovery, persist) {
  EXPECT_EQ(0, access("/system/bin/recovery-persist", F_OK));

  ssize_t ret = __android_log_pmsg_file_read(
      LOG_ID_SYSTEM, ANDROID_LOG_INFO, "recovery/", __pmsg_fn, nullptr);
  if (ret == -ENOENT) {
    EXPECT_LT(0, __android_log_pmsg_file_write(LOG_ID_SYSTEM, ANDROID_LOG_INFO,
        myFilename.c_str(), myContent.c_str(), myContent.size()));

    fprintf(stderr, "injected test data, requires intervening reboot "
        "to check for storage\n");
  }

  std::string buf;
  EXPECT_TRUE(android::base::ReadFileToString(myFilename, &buf));
  EXPECT_EQ(myContent, buf);
  if (access(myFilename.c_str(), F_OK) == 0) {
    fprintf(stderr, "Removing persistent test data, "
        "check if reconstructed on reboot\n");
  }
  EXPECT_EQ(0, unlink(myFilename.c_str()));
}
